What Are Electromagnetic Fields (EMFs)?
At its core, an electromagnetic field (EMF) is a physical field produced by electrically charged objects. These fields are characterized as either low-frequency (non-ionizing) or high-frequency (ionizing), and each type interacts with the human body differently.
- Low-Frequency EMFs include those generated by your household electronics, power lines, and even natural sources like the Earth's magnetic field. These are considered non-ionizing and generally less harmful due to their lower energy levels.
- High-Frequency EMFs, on the other hand, include X-rays, ultraviolet (UV) rays, and gamma rays. These ionize tissues at a cellular level and pose a well-documented risk, such as DNA damage.

Common Sources of EMF Exposure
Modern convenience comes with an invisible price tag—EMF emissions from everyday devices. Here’s a breakdown of some of the most common culprits:
1. Consumer Electronics
If you’re reading this blog on your laptop or smartphone, you’re already interacting with EMF-emitting devices. Phones, tablets, and wearables like smartwatches emit radiofrequency fields (a form of low-frequency EMF) as they maintain Wi-Fi or cellular connections.
Key Stats:
- According to a Pew Research study, 85% of U.S. adults own a smartphone, meaning a majority carry these EMFs in their pockets daily.
- Devices like fitness trackers worn 24/7 expose users to consistent low-level EMFs.
2. Wi-Fi Routers and Networks
The internet has become central to how we live and work, and this is powered by Wi-Fi, a significant source of EMFs. While low powered, routers operate continuously, emitting fields throughout your home.
Fun Fact:
Did you know that Wi-Fi routers typically pulse RF waves at 2.4 GHz or 5 GHz frequencies? While this makes for smooth streaming and browsing, it’s also a constant EMF source.
3. Household Appliances
Microwaves, refrigerators, washing machines, and other appliances emit EMFs whenever they’re powered on. Even some modern LED lights produce electromagnetic fields.
Surprising Sources:
EMFs aren’t limited to "smart" devices. Regular corded electrical devices like hair dryers and electric shavers can generate significant levels over short durations.
4. Power Lines
Even if power lines seem far removed from daily life, they contribute significantly to EMF exposure for those living nearby. High-voltage lines generate electromagnetic fields as electricity travels through them.
5. Smart Home Devices
The rise of smart homes—a $97.26 billion industry in 2023—means connected devices, from voice assistants to automated thermostats, blanket homes with signals. These devices rely on constant communication over Wi-Fi and Bluetooth, adding to your EMF load.

Understanding the Health Risks of EMF Exposure
While EMF exposure from non-ionizing fields is generally considered safe, concerns remain, especially regarding long-term exposure. Public conversations often ask the same question:
“Can EMFs really harm our health?”
Short-Term Effects
For most individuals, short-term low-frequency EMF exposure doesn’t cause immediate harm. However, sensitivity varies between individuals. Some report discomfort or symptoms often grouped under "electromagnetic hypersensitivity (EHS)." These may include:
- Headaches
- Fatigue
- Sleep disturbances
- Increased stress levels
Although scientific evidence behind EHS is debated, self-reporting of these symptoms continues to grow.
Long-Term Concerns
The long-term effects of chronic EMF exposure remain a contested topic in scientific circles. However, some studies have raised potential red flags:
- Cancer Concerns: The International Agency for Research on Cancer (IARC) has classified RF radiation as "possibly carcinogenic to humans," linking it to brain tumor risks (with prolonged cellphone use cited as a potential factor).
- Biological Impact:
- Chronic exposure to EMFs may interfere with melatonin production, potentially affecting sleep.
- Animal studies indicate prolonged RF-EMF exposure could alter mitochondrial DNA or cause oxidative stress.
- Childhood Vulnerability: Children's thinner skulls make them more vulnerable to EMF absorption. Extended screen time near devices could be more impactful for younger generations.

Reducing EMF Exposure in Daily Life
The good news? You don’t need to ditch your smartphone or go fully off-grid. Implementing a few small, thoughtful tweaks can significantly reduce your EMF exposure.
1. Limit Screen Time
While smartphones and laptops are unavoidable for work or entertainment, aim to keep them farther away when not in use:
- Use speakerphone during calls instead of holding devices against your ear.
- Avoid sleeping with devices (like phones) next to your head.
2. Create a Tech-Free Sleep Zone
The bedroom should be a sanctuary. Consider powering down EMF-emitting devices like Wi-Fi routers during the night or moving them out of the bedroom entirely.
3. Monitor Smart Device Usage
If you're using smart home gadgets like thermostats and speakers, evaluate whether they're truly essential. Turning off unused devices saves energy and reduces EMFs.
4. Opt for Wired Connections
Switch from wireless to wired whenever possible:
- Use Ethernet cables instead of Wi-Fi for your internet needs.
- Replace Bluetooth headphones with wired ones.
5. Childproof Devices
If you’re a parent, ensure kids use tablets and phones minimally, especially for non-essential activities. Encourage traditional play over tech-dependent entertainment.
6. Invest in EMF Shields
Many EMF-shielding products have entered the market, from cases for smartphones to specialized paint that blocks EMFs in specific rooms. While not a magic bullet, these options add a layer of protection.
Pro Tip:
Check your device manuals for “SAR value” (Specific Absorption Rate). Lower SAR values usually indicate lower EMF emissions.
